The IHSAA's Policy Change and its Rationale
The IHSAA's new policy effectively prohibits transgender girls from competing in girls' sports at the high school level in Indiana. The stated rationale centers on the IHSAA's interpretation of Title IX, heavily influenced by the Trump administration's policies regarding sex-based classifications in education. The association argues that allowing transgender girls to compete gives them an unfair competitive advantage over cisgender girls.
- Specifics of the policy: The policy requires students to compete according to the sex assigned at birth, with limited exceptions rarely granted. This includes rigorous verification processes often involving documentation of gender assignment at birth. All sports, from basketball and volleyball to track and field, are affected.

Legal Challenges and Ongoing Opposition to the Ban
The IHSAA's policy has faced immediate and substantial legal challenges. Lawsuits have been filed arguing that the ban violates the Equal Protection Clause of the Fourteenth Amendment and Title IX, which prohibits sex discrimination in federally funded education programs.
- Summary of legal arguments for and against the ban: Supporters of the ban argue for fair competition and the preservation of girls' sports. Opponents argue that the ban is discriminatory and harms the mental and physical well-being of transgender girls. The legal arguments hinge on the definition of sex and the interpretation of Title IX's protections against sex-based discrimination.

The Impact on Transgender Girls and their Families
The IHSAA ban has devastating consequences for transgender girls and their families. Exclusion from sports leads to feelings of isolation, decreased self-esteem, and increased mental health challenges. The loss of a crucial social and physical activity can be particularly damaging during adolescence.
- Psychological effects of exclusion from sports: Participating in sports provides numerous benefits for mental and physical health. Exclusion from sports due to discriminatory policies can lead to depression, anxiety, and feelings of inadequacy.
- Impact on social integration and well-being: Team sports are often crucial for social integration and development. Exclusion from sports can isolate transgender girls, affecting their social development and overall well-being.
